Transaction 67b3d16e46de755397bf893a95e13720be0d4c11b413242ab633a21e8fb80746

block
cd12c87e244015ac082aeac064c139b76e6d18d075e90cd1be3e9bd81ceccbf7

3 Inputs

501 Outputs